Ed-Zulu Posted September 18, 2018 Share And some not so good news!https://www.msn.com/en-za/money/personalfinance/listen-big-online-shopper-sars-has-its-eyes-on-you-and-your-imports/ar-BBNhGoq?ocid=spartandhpSARS allows individuals to import goods (online purchases included) of up to R60,000-00 in value annually (personal consumption), without the need for import permits. Duties on goods remain payable. When you exceed the value ceiling, you need to apply for an import/export permit and all eyes are on you. Due to low fiscus at the moment SARS will look for every legal and conceivable way to tax goods, service etc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
